What Do Wings Symbolize in Jewelry?

Wing symbols in jewelry represent far more than decoration.

Across cultures and eras, wings have consistently symbolized the idea of moving beyond limitation—physically, emotionally, and spiritually.

In modern jewelry, especially men’s jewelry, wing designs are no longer just aesthetic elements. They are used as identity symbols, expressing freedom, resilience, and personal direction.

Today, wing jewelry is commonly worn by people who value:

  • Independence
  • Self-expression
  • Inner strength
  • Personal transformation
  • A sense of direction in life

Unlike trend-based motifs, wing jewelry remains relevant because it carries a meaning that evolves with the wearer.


What Do Wings Symbolize? (Core Meaning Explained)

Wing symbolism is rooted in one universal idea:

Wings represent the ability to rise above limits.

This simple concept has developed into multiple layered meanings in modern jewelry culture.

1. Freedom & Independence

Wings symbolize breaking away from restriction—whether social, emotional, or personal.

This is why wing jewelry is often chosen during life transitions such as:

  • starting a new career
  • moving to a new place
  • ending a relationship
  • rebuilding confidence

In jewelry psychology, wings often represent the desire to “take control of direction again.”


2. Protection & Guidance

Across many cultures, wings also represent protection.

Wing imagery often appears in symbolic guardianship themes—something that “covers” or “shields” the wearer.

In modern interpretation, this becomes:

  • emotional protection
  • inner safety
  • guidance during uncertainty

This is one reason wing jewelry is frequently given as a meaningful personal gift.


3. Strength & Resilience

Wings are not only about softness or spirituality.

Flight requires:

  • balance
  • control
  • strength
  • endurance

This is why wing jewelry is also associated with resilience—especially for people who have overcome setbacks or rebuilt their life direction.


4. Ambition & Personal Growth

In modern lifestyle symbolism, wings often represent:

  • upward movement in life
  • ambition
  • continuous self-improvement
  • refusal to stay stagnant

This interpretation is especially strong in men’s jewelry culture, where symbolism is often tied to identity and mindset rather than decoration.


The History of Wing Symbolism in Jewelry

Wing symbolism is one of the oldest visual languages in human design.

Ancient Egypt: Protection & Divinity

In Ancient Egypt, winged figures were commonly used to represent divine protection.

Goddesses like Isis were depicted with extended wings symbolizing:

  • guardianship
  • healing energy
  • spiritual protection

Wing motifs also appeared in amulets and ceremonial objects.


Ancient Greece: Speed & Transcendence

In Greek mythology, wings were associated with gods and messengers.

The god Hermes, known for his winged sandals, symbolized:

  • speed
  • communication
  • movement between worlds

Here, wings became a symbol of transcending physical limitation.


Medieval & Religious Symbolism

In medieval European art, wings were strongly associated with angelic imagery.

This reinforced meanings such as:

  • protection
  • hope
  • moral guidance
  • spiritual connection

Over time, wings evolved from religious symbols into broader cultural icons.
